What is the Child Health History Form?
The Child Health History Form is a vital document designed to gather comprehensive health information about a child. It plays a key role in ensuring that healthcare providers have access to essential details, such as medical history and emergency contacts, which are crucial for delivering proper pediatric care. This form is specifically intended for parents and guardians to complete and should be utilized during health evaluations, school registrations, or any medical appointments.

Key Features of the Child Health History Form
The Child Health History Form includes several key components that are important for thorough documentation. These features encompass sections for:
-
Medical history, including allergies and past illnesses.
-
Emergency contacts that ensure swift communication if issues arise.
-
Insurance information, necessary for billing and coverage purposes.
Additionally, signing by both parents and physicians is required for the form to be valid, which reinforces the importance of shared responsibility in a child's health care.

Gathering Information for the Child Health History Form
Before filling out the Child Health History Form, it is important to compile necessary details. Key information includes:
-
Child's medical history, including previous illnesses and surgeries.
-
Current vaccination status, which can be documented in the immunization record form.
-
Emergency contacts and insurance details.

Who is eligible to fill out the Child Health History Form?
The Child Health History Form should be filled out by a parent or legal guardian of the child, along with the child's physician for validation.
What information do I need before completing the form?
Before starting, gather your child's name, address, insurance information, medical history, immunization records, and contact details for emergencies.
